58 7 3 Press the shutter release button fully. For g, the self-timer lamp starts blinking slowly and blinks rapidly two seconds before the shutter is released. The beep is heard and the rate increases. The shutter will be released about 12 seconds after the shutter release button is pressed fully. For r, the shutter will be released about two seconds after the shutter release button is pressed fully. 1 The beep can be turned off. "Turning the Beep On and Off" (p.163) Basic Operations • Exposure may be affected if light enters the viewfinder. Attach the provided ME viewfinder cap or use the AE lock function (p.142). (Ignore the light entering the viewfinder when the exposure mode is set to a (Manual) (p.138).) • Remove the Eyecup FN by pulling one side out and toward you when using accessories such as the ME viewfinder cap. Removing the Eyecup FN Attaching the ME Viewfinder cap 8 Turn the camera off after shooting. The next time the power is turned on, self-timer shooting is canceled and returns to single frame shooting.
